Why are impact craters rare on the surface of earth but plentiful on the moon?

Impact craters are rare on the surface of the earth and plentiful on the moon its because our atmosphere burns up more meteoroids before they meet the surface. Another reason is that the surface of the earth is continually active and erases the marks of crater overtime. There are also many other large craters being found in Canada, Australia and Africa.
